Match the LIST-I with LIST-II\[\begin{array}{|c|c|} \hline \textbf{LIST-I} & \textbf{LIST-II} \\ \hline \text{A. Lag} & \text{I. Speed of response} \\ \hline \text{B. Static and dynamic error} & \text{II. Fidelity} \\ \hline \text{C. Drift} & \text{III. Reproducibility} \\ \hline \text{D. Sensitivity} & \text{IV. Precision} \\ \hline \end{array}\] Choose the correct answer from the options given below:

  • A - I, B - II, C - III, D - IV
  • A - I, B - III, C - IV, D - II
  • A - II, B - IV, C - III, D - I
  • A - III, B - IV, C - I, D - II
Show Solution

The Correct Option is A

Solution and Explanation

Step 1: Associate terms with their corresponding properties.
- Lag signifies a delay, thus it relates to Speed of response (I).
- Static and dynamic error indicate the discrepancy between input and output, thereby linking them to Fidelity (II).
- Drift denotes a gradual alteration in measurement over time, hence it is connected to Reproducibility (III).
- Sensitivity measures the capability to detect minor changes, leading to its association with Precision (IV).

Step 2: Confirm the associations.
The resultant associations are: A $\to$ I, B $\to$ II, C $\to$ III, D $\to$ IV.

Step 3: Final determination.
The accurate selection is (A).
